be-swícend
A deceiver ⬩ impostor
Entry preview:
A deceiver, impostor Eálá þú sǽ, unscæððígra beswícend, Ap. Th. 11. 10. Bisuícend (-suíccend, -suiccend) impostorem, Txts. 70, 545. Biswícend, Wrt. Voc. ii. 45, 54

fǽr-stice
A stitch
Entry preview:
A stitch, sudden pain Wið fǽrstice (cf. the refrain of the charm that follows: Út lytel spere, gif hér inne sié), Lch. iii. 52, 11
fæþm-lic
embracing ⬩ encompassing ⬩ sinuous
Entry preview:
embracing, encompassing Sý þín þæt fæþmlice hrif mid eallum fægernessum gefrætwod, Bl. H. 7, 28. sinuous Ðǽm fæðmlice sinuosis (flexibus), Wrt. Voc. ii. 74, 65

un-wuniendlíc
Uninhabitable
Entry preview:
Uninhabitable Beóð twégen dǽlas on twá healfa ðam gemetegodum dǽle unwuniendlíce, for ðan ðe seó sunne ne cymð him nǽfre tó, Lchdm. iii. 262, 2

wǽg-hengest
A sea-steed ⬩ a ship
Entry preview:
A sea-steed, a ship Hé bát gestág, wǽghengest wræc, Exon. Th. 181, 34; Gú. 1303. Hí gehlódon hildesercum wǽghengestas, Elen. Kmbl. 472; El. 236
brim-gæst
a guest ⬩ A sea-guest ⬩ sailor ⬩ marinus hospes ⬩ nauta
Entry preview:
A sea-guest, sailor; marinus hospes, nauta Biþ hlúd brimgiesta breahtm the sailors' noise is loud, Exon. 101 b; Th. 384, 9; Rä. 4, 25
